The Election Commission of India (ECI) has announced that it will set up mobile phone deposit counters at polling stations to ensure that voters do not have to carry their phones inside the polling booth. This decision was taken after it was observed that several voters were concealing their phones in their clothes due to the absence of a facility to deposit it. The ECI has also rationalized the permissible norms for canvassing in line with the electoral laws to 100 meters from the entrance of the polling station.

After a record-breaking year, India's automobile industry is entering 2026 on a relatively strong footing, with sales growth expected in the 6-8 per cent range. The outlook is underpinned by policy support, including GST rationalisation, easing monetary conditions, and income tax relief, which together are likely to improve affordability and sustain consumer demand across vehicle segments.

Truck rentals saw a positive momentum across most key trunk routes due to an increased pre-kharif agricultural activity and a resilient manufacturing sector. The Kolkata-Guwahati-Kolkata corridor witnessed a month-on-month (M-o-M) rise of 2.4 per cent, while the Mumbai-Chennai-Mumbai route grew by 1.9 per cent and the Delhi-Hyderabad-Delhi route saw a 1.6 per cent increase in truck rentals, said June edition of the Shriram Mobility Bulletin.
